DIY: Colorful Pumpkins
Check out these cheerful and colorful fall pumpkins!
MATERIAL:
- Pumpkins, I bought a package of 5 small pumpkins for $3 dollars.
- Acrylic paint, each small bottle cost a dollar.
- A paint brush
STEPS:
1. Paint the bottom half of each pumpkin.
2. Drop some dots of paint on the pumpkins and flip them upside down for a couple of seconds letting the paint drip down the pumpkin.
3. Find a great place in your living room for them and have fun!
I spent about 10 minutes on this project, but this small splash of color brought so much joy to my home, they are so colorful and happy!
